  • Title

    Applying Low-Voltage Circuit Breakers to Limit Arc-Flash Energy

  • Abstract
    The purpose of this paper is to examine the application of low-voltage circuit breakers to control the energy released during an arc-flash occurrence. It contrasts arc-flash incident-energy values obtained by calculation with values obtained by direct testing. It examines values at low fault current levels where long duration events may be expected. It also reviews the protection afforded by current-limiting circuit breakers. This paper concludes with an overall discussion of circuit breaker applications for arc-flash energy reduction.
